Apple has just announced the AirPods Max 2 with better noise cancellation and sound quality. The second generation of Apple's over-ear headphones starts at $549 and comes equipped with an H2 chip that powers a bunch of new features, including AI-powered live translation, which translates speech to your preferred language in real-time.

As noted by Apple, the AirPods Max 2 offer active noise-cancellation that's 1.5 times more effective when compared to the original AirPods Max, which launched in 2020.
